Propargyl bromide, 80% in toluene is used to prepare betulonic acid-peptide conjugates with anti-inflammatory activity and propargylic amines employed in enyne metathesis. It finds application in the propargylation of spiro ketones, allylic alcohols and enone complexes. In Barbier-type reaction, it reacts with aldehydes to give alkyne alcohols. It is actively involved in the synthesis of polyethylene glycol (PEG) and peptide-grafted polyesters.

Solubility
Miscible with ethanol, ether, benzene, carbon tetrachloride and chloroform. Immiscible with water.
Notes
Light sensitive. Store in a cool place. Incompatible withbases, strong oxidizing agents, copper, peroxides, silver, silver oxides, mercury and mercury oxides.
